HIV/AIDS kills 10,000 people in Ghana annually – Expert

At least 10,000 people die from HIV/AIDS in Ghana every year, according to Ernest Amoabeng Ortsin, President of the Ghana HIV and AIDS Network.

He revealed that 334,000 individuals tested positive for the virus for the first time in 2023, with 12.3% of STI cases linked to HIV.

Despite ongoing awareness campaigns, Ortsin criticized the government’s limited support for HIV/AIDS prevention and treatment programs.

He called for increased funding to curb the spread, particularly in high-prevalence regions like Eastern, Western, and Greater Accra.
